Job Description Summary

The Revit Technician is responsible for developing and maintaining Revit models, templates and families used both internally and externally for the creation of piping models. This position will support the BIM Manager in ensuring the accuracy and functionality of Viega CAD content to improve the user experience and influence the inclusion and specification of Viega products. They will work closely with the Digital Content Specialist to provide technical support and solutions to anyone modeling with Viega press fittings and accessories.

Responsibilities

  • Create Revit families of Viega press fittings and accessories.
  • Create Revit families of miscellaneous plumbing and piping components.
  • Create Revit models of buildings from source construction documents.
  • Modify existing Revit families to update geometry or improve functionality.
  • Modify or add parameter data to Revit families or projects.
  • Modify Revit templates as necessary.
  • Troubleshoot issues related to families, templates, or cloud-services.
  • Consult with customers to understand workflows and suggest improvements.
  • Assist team members with Revit project setup.
  • Assist team members with Revit sheet setup.
  • Assist team members with generating material lists from Revit models.

Required Qualifications

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ment.
  • Proficient in the use of Autodesk products including Revit, AutoCAD, Navisworks etc.
  • Proficient in the use of Autodesk Construction Cloud (ACC).
  • Proficient in the use of Bluebeam Revu.
  • Familiarity with common CAD file types such as DWG, DXF, DGN, RFA etc.
  • Familiarity with common 3D file formats such as STEP, IGES, VRML/X3D etc.
  • Proficient in the use of Microsoft products including Excel, Word, PowerPoint and Teams.
  • Keen attention to detail.
  • Effective communication skills, both verbally and in writing.

Education, Certification/License & Work Experience

  • Autodesk Certified Professional in Revit or similar certification(s).
  • 2 years of experience managing CAD/BIM content in a building construction environment.
  • 2 years of experience creating and editing Revit families.
  • 2 years of experience creating and editing Revit parameter data.
  • 2 years of experience modeling piping systems.

A minimum of 5 years of relevant experience or equivalent combinations of education and experience may be considered.
